Shrimp Fettucine Alfredo
This Alfredo Pasta Recipe with Shrimp hits just the spot. Creamy shrimp alfredo make in a large skillet over pasta with freshly grated parmesan cheese, cooked shrimp, heavy cream and butter cooked over medium heat.

Servings: 4
Calories: 1069kcal
- 400 grams Fettuccine Pasta
- ¾ pounds Shrimp 16 large, deveined, cleaned and tail removed
- 1 teaspoon salt
- pepper to taste
- 8 tablespoons of Butter
- 2 cups Heavy Cream
- 1 ½ cup parmesan cheese
- Parsley for garnish optional
Cook pasta as per box directions. Reserve 1 cup of the pasta water.
While pasta is cooking pat dry the shrimp with a paper towel and place them in a plate.
Cook the shrimp in a skillet with 2 tablespoons of the butter. Season with salt and pepper to taste. You will know they are cooked with they are no longer translucent and pink in color. Transfer to a plate.
Add remaining butter and let melt. Add heavy cream and parmesan cheese and stir to a light boil.
Add pasta and shrimp and mix to combine. If the sauce is too thick use, the pasta water to thin it out.
Garnish with parsley (optional) and serve immediately.
